Position Summary
The NA sales manager provides technical support and direct customer engagement to ensure order winning in their region or sub-region. Responsible for working with UK based engineering and delivering in country technical/commercial capability to ensure the order intake target (at margins that support business growth) is achieved. Identifies objectives, strategies and action plans to improve long‑term sales and company growth. Builds high level relationships with existing and new customers;
including relevant technical teams and departments.
